当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储教程是什么意思,深入浅出,对象存储教程全解析

对象存储教程是什么意思,深入浅出,对象存储教程全解析

对象存储教程旨在全面解析对象存储技术,深入浅出地讲解其概念、原理和应用。教程涵盖对象存储的架构、API、数据管理、安全性和性能优化等内容,旨在帮助读者快速掌握对象存储技...

对象存储教程旨在全面解析对象存储技术,深入浅出地讲解其概念、原理和应用。教程涵盖对象存储的架构、API、数据管理、安全性和性能优化等内容,旨在帮助读者快速掌握对象存储技术,应用于实际项目中。

随着互联网的飞速发展,数据量呈爆炸式增长,传统的存储方式已经无法满足需求,为了更好地管理海量数据,对象存储应运而生,本文将为您详细解析对象存储教程,帮助您了解对象存储的基本概念、工作原理、应用场景以及相关技术。

对象存储教程是什么意思,深入浅出,对象存储教程全解析

对象存储基本概念

1、什么是对象存储?

对象存储(Object Storage)是一种基于文件的存储方式,将数据存储为一个个独立的对象,每个对象由元数据、数据和唯一标识符组成,对象存储系统以文件系统的方式组织数据,用户可以像访问普通文件一样操作存储对象。

2、对象存储与传统存储方式的区别

(1)数据结构:对象存储以对象为单位存储数据,而传统存储方式以文件为单位。

(2)数据访问:对象存储支持HTTP协议,方便数据共享和访问;传统存储方式以文件系统为基础,访问方式较为复杂。

(3)数据安全性:对象存储系统具有高可靠性和容错性,能够有效保障数据安全;传统存储方式在数据安全性方面相对较弱。

对象存储工作原理

1、存储架构

对象存储系统通常采用分布式架构,将数据分散存储在多个节点上,每个节点负责存储一部分数据,并与其他节点协同工作,提高数据存储和访问效率。

对象存储教程是什么意思,深入浅出,对象存储教程全解析

2、数据存储流程

(1)数据上传:用户将数据上传至对象存储系统,系统生成唯一标识符(如UUID)和元数据,并将数据存储在指定的节点上。

(2)数据检索:用户通过唯一标识符检索数据,系统返回数据及元数据。

(3)数据更新:用户对存储的数据进行修改,系统将更新后的数据覆盖原有数据。

(4)数据删除:用户删除数据,系统从存储节点中移除该数据。

3、数据冗余与容错

对象存储系统通过数据冗余和容错机制保证数据安全性,数据冗余是指将数据存储在多个节点上,以防止单个节点故障导致数据丢失,容错机制则是在系统发生故障时,自动切换至其他正常节点,保证数据访问不受影响。

对象存储应用场景

1、大数据存储:对象存储系统具有高扩展性和低成本特点,适用于存储海量数据,如日志、图片、视频等。

对象存储教程是什么意思,深入浅出,对象存储教程全解析

2、云计算:对象存储系统可以作为云计算平台的基础设施,为用户提供数据存储服务。

3、物联网:对象存储系统可以存储物联网设备产生的海量数据,如传感器数据、设备状态等。

分发网络(CDN):对象存储系统可以作为CDN的基础设施,提高内容分发速度和效率。

对象存储相关技术

1、元数据管理:元数据包括对象的名称、类型、大小、创建时间等信息,元数据管理技术负责维护对象的元数据,方便用户检索和访问。

2、数据压缩与解压缩:为了提高存储效率,对象存储系统通常采用数据压缩技术,数据压缩和解压缩技术负责对数据进行压缩和解压缩处理。

3、数据加密:数据加密技术用于保护存储在对象存储系统中的数据,防止数据泄露。

4、数据备份与恢复:数据备份技术用于定期备份存储数据,以便在数据丢失或损坏时进行恢复。

黑狐家游戏

发表评论

最新文章